Transport workers strike in support of ILPS

Image

Press Trust of India Imphal
Public transport was today hit across Manipur as both state government department personnel and private operators boycotted work in support of the demand for implementation of Inner Line Permit System in the state.

The strike paralysed movement of inter-state and inter-district bus and taxi services in the land-bound state.

There was no autorickshaw or private taxis on the streets of the capital town of Imphal and the attendance at the main market Kwairamban was thin.

Trucks too kept off the road and only a few non-commercial vehicles were seen plying.

The agitation for implementation of ILPS since July 8 has seen the death of a student and the indefinite curfew relaxed in Greater Imphal on that day is still on, albeit with daily relaxations.
 

The agitation is being spearheaded by Joint Committee on Inner Line Permit System (JCILPS) to "safeguard the interests of the indigenous people".
